Had shingles almost 40 years ago..


It follows a nerve on your body. Mine was from my spine around my torso almost to my belly button. Very painful. Back then all the Dr. could do was give me a spray that acted by freezing the skin temporarily so that the pain subsided. Never want to get that again!
